package javax.swing;

import java.awt.Component;
import java.beans.PropertyVetoException;

import javax.accessibility.Accessible;
import javax.accessibility.AccessibleContext;
import javax.accessibility.AccessibleRole;
import javax.swing.plaf.DesktopPaneUI;

/**
 * JDesktopPane is a container (usually for JInternalFrames) that simulates a
 * desktop. Typically, the user will create JInternalFrames and place thme in
 * a JDesktopPane. The user can then interact with JInternalFrames like they
 * usually would with JFrames. The actions (minimize, maximize, close, etc)
 * are done by using a DesktopManager that is associated with the
 * JDesktopPane.
 */
public class JDesktopPane extends JLayeredPane implements Accessible
{
  /** DOCUMENT ME! */
  private static final long serialVersionUID = 766333777224038726L;

  /**
   * This specifies that when dragged, a JInternalFrame should be completely
   * visible.
   *
   * @specnote final since 1.5.0.
   */
  public static final int LIVE_DRAG_MODE = 0;

  /**
   * This specifies that when dragged, a JInternalFrame should only be visible
   * as an outline.
   *
   * @specnote final since 1.5.0.
   */
  public static final int OUTLINE_DRAG_MODE = 1;

  /** The selected frame in the JDesktopPane. */
  private transient JInternalFrame selectedFrame;

  /** The JDesktopManager to use for acting on JInternalFrames. */
  transient DesktopManager desktopManager;

  /** The drag mode used by the JDesktopPane. */
  private transient int dragMode = LIVE_DRAG_MODE;

  /**
   * AccessibleJDesktopPane
   */
  protected class AccessibleJDesktopPane extends AccessibleJComponent
  {
    /** DOCUMENT ME! */
    private static final long serialVersionUID = 6079388927946077570L;

    /**
     * Constructor AccessibleJDesktopPane
     */
    protected AccessibleJDesktopPane()
    {
    }

    /**
     * getAccessibleRole
     *
     * @return AccessibleRole
     */
    public AccessibleRole getAccessibleRole()
    {
      return AccessibleRole.DESKTOP_PANE;
    }
  }

  /**
   * Creates a new JDesktopPane object.
   */
  public JDesktopPane()
  {
    setLayout(null);
    updateUI();
  }

  /**
   * This method returns the UI used with the JDesktopPane.
   *
   * @return The UI used with the JDesktopPane.
   */
  public DesktopPaneUI getUI()
  {
    return (DesktopPaneUI) ui;
  }

  /**
   * This method sets the UI used with the JDesktopPane.
   *
   * @param ui The UI to use with the JDesktopPane.
   */
  public void setUI(DesktopPaneUI ui)
  {
    super.setUI(ui);
  }

  /**
   * This method sets the drag mode to use with the JDesktopPane.
   *
   * @param mode The drag mode to use.
   *
   * @throws IllegalArgumentException If the drag mode given is not
   *         LIVE_DRAG_MODE or OUTLINE_DRAG_MODE.
   */
  public void setDragMode(int mode)
  {
    if ((mode != LIVE_DRAG_MODE) && (mode != OUTLINE_DRAG_MODE))
      throw new IllegalArgumentException("Drag mode not valid.");

    // FIXME: Unsupported mode.
    if (mode == OUTLINE_DRAG_MODE)
      {
        // throw new IllegalArgumentException("Outline drag modes are unsupported.");
        mode = LIVE_DRAG_MODE;
      }

    dragMode = mode;
  }

  /**
   * This method returns the drag mode used with the JDesktopPane.
   *
   * @return The drag mode used with the JDesktopPane.
   */
  public int getDragMode()
  {
    return dragMode;
  }

  /**
   * This method returns the DesktopManager used with the JDesktopPane.
   *
   * @return The DesktopManager to use with the JDesktopPane.
   */
  public DesktopManager getDesktopManager()
  {
    return desktopManager;
  }

  /**
   * This method sets the DesktopManager to use with the JDesktopPane.
   *
   * @param manager The DesktopManager to use with the JDesktopPane.
   */
  public void setDesktopManager(DesktopManager manager)
  {
    desktopManager = manager;
  }

  /**
   * This method restores the UI used with the JDesktopPane to the default.
   */
  public void updateUI()
  {
    setUI((DesktopPaneUI) UIManager.getUI(this));
    invalidate();
  }

  /**
   * This method returns a String identifier that allows the UIManager to know
   * which class will act as JDesktopPane's UI.
   *
   * @return A String identifier for the UI class to use.
   */
  public String getUIClassID()
  {
    return "DesktopPaneUI";
  }

  /**
   * This method returns all JInternalFrames that are in the JDesktopPane.
   *
   * @return All JInternalFrames that are in the JDesktopPane.
   */
  public JInternalFrame[] getAllFrames()
  {
    return getFramesFromComponents(getComponents());
  }

  /**
   * This method returns the currently selected frame in the JDesktopPane.
   *
   * @return The currently selected frame in the JDesktopPane.
   */
  public JInternalFrame getSelectedFrame()
  {
    return selectedFrame;
  }

  /**
   * This method sets the selected frame in the JDesktopPane.
   *
   * @param frame The selected frame in the JDesktopPane.
   */
  public void setSelectedFrame(JInternalFrame frame)
  {
    if (selectedFrame != null)
      {
	try
	  {
	    selectedFrame.setSelected(false);
	  }
	catch (PropertyVetoException e)
	  {
	  }
      }
    selectedFrame = null;

    try
      {
	if (frame != null)
	  frame.setSelected(true);

	selectedFrame = frame;
      }
    catch (PropertyVetoException e)
      {
      }
  }

  /**
   * This method returns all the JInternalFrames in the given layer.
   *
   * @param layer The layer to grab frames in.
   *
   * @return All JInternalFrames in the given layer.
   */
  public JInternalFrame[] getAllFramesInLayer(int layer)
  {
    return getFramesFromComponents(getComponentsInLayer(layer));
  }

  /**
   * This method always returns true to indicate that it is not transparent.
   *
   * @return true.
   */
  public boolean isOpaque()
  {
    return true;
  }

  /**
   * This method returns a String that describes the JDesktopPane.
   *
   * @return A String that describes the JDesktopPane.
   */
  protected String paramString()
  {
    return "JDesktopPane";
  }

  /**
   * This method returns all the JInternalFrames in the given Component array.
   *
   * @param components An array to search for JInternalFrames in.
   *
   * @return An array of JInternalFrames found in the Component array.
   */
  private static JInternalFrame[] getFramesFromComponents(Component[] components)
  {
    int count = 0;

    for (int i = 0; i < components.length; i++)
	if (components[i] instanceof JInternalFrame)
	  count++;
	  
    JInternalFrame[] value = new JInternalFrame[count];
    for (int i = 0, j = 0; i < components.length && j != count; i++)
      if (components[i] instanceof JInternalFrame)
	value[j++] = (JInternalFrame) components[i];
    return value;
  }

  /**
   * getAccessibleContext
   *
   * @return AccessibleContext
   */
  public AccessibleContext getAccessibleContext()
  {
    if (accessibleContext == null)
      accessibleContext = new AccessibleJDesktopPane();

    return accessibleContext;
  }
}
